Quick question Dee. You say the schedule is nuts, he like many others moved across country, etc. Do you think IMG really is worth it for these kids? Is the competition that much better, structure, coaching? Very interested in your reply and what the benefits are of being there. Thanks.

Personally I feel it's a lil overboard. Without question they do prepare you for college and beyond but they take the youth from these children. They practice,review film & workout all day. They go to school at night. He literally doesn't get to relax until 8pm every night... besides that the coaches have alot of agendas & play favorites. The preparation is top notch but honestly the majority of the top private schools would have been better options for most. In hindsight everything probably wouldve been different.
